What Are 4k IPTV Subs and How Do They Work?

4k IPTV subs refer to subscriptions for Internet Protocol Television services that deliver content in Ultra High Definition (UHD) resolution, commonly known as 4K. Unlike traditional broadcast or cable TV, IPTV streams video directly over the internet. This technology allows for a vast array of channels, movies, and on-demand content to be delivered to your compatible devices.

The core mechanism involves a server hosting the content, which then transmits it to your device via your internet connection. When you subscribe to a 4k IPTV service, you gain access to these servers. Your device, whether it’s a smart TV, streaming box, or mobile phone, uses an IPTV app or player to decode and display the streams. The “4K” aspect means these streams are encoded at a much higher resolution, typically 3840×2160 pixels, offering four times the detail of standard Full HD.

The quality of your internet connection is paramount for enjoying 4k iptv subs. A stable, high-speed connection ensures smooth playback without buffering. Many providers offer a full channel list, including premium sports and movie channels, all available in stunning 4K clarity.

Setting Up Your 4k IPTV Service

Getting started with 4k iptv subs is generally straightforward. First, you’ll need a reliable internet connection. For smooth 4K streaming, a minimum speed of 25 Mbps is recommended, though 50 Mbps or higher is ideal to avoid any interruptions. For SD content, 5-10 Mbps is usually sufficient, while HD content requires around 15-20 Mbps.

Next, you’ll need a compatible device. This could be a 4K smart TV with a built-in IPTV app, an Android TV box, an Amazon Fire Stick 4K, an Apple TV 4K, or even a powerful computer. You can find information on supported IPTV devices on most provider websites. Once you have your device, you’ll typically download an IPTV player application. Many popular choices exist, such as IPTV Smarters Pro, TiviMate, or GSE Smart IPTV.

After installing the app, you’ll receive login credentials from your IPTV provider, usually in the form of an M3U URL, Xtream Codes API details, or a Stalker Portal address. You simply enter these details into your chosen IPTV player, and the service will load your channels and VOD library. A quick restart of the app might be necessary to finalize the setup.

Optimizing Performance and Troubleshooting Common Issues

To ensure the best experience with your 4k iptv subs, several optimization steps can be taken. Always use a wired Ethernet connection instead of Wi-Fi for your primary streaming device if possible. This provides a more stable and faster connection, reducing latency and buffering. If Wi-Fi is your only option, ensure your router is centrally located and supports modern standards like Wi-Fi 5 (802.11ac) or Wi-Fi 6 (802.11ax).

Buffering is a common issue that can often be resolved by checking your internet speed, clearing the cache of your IPTV app, or restarting your router and streaming device. If a particular channel is consistently buffering, it might be an issue on the provider’s end, and contacting their support is advisable. Some apps also allow you to adjust the buffer size, which can help in certain situations.

If you encounter freezing or stuttering, ensure your device’s firmware and your IPTV app are updated to the latest versions. Overheating can also affect performance, so ensure your streaming device has adequate ventilation. Sometimes, switching to a different IPTV player app can also resolve compatibility or performance issues with particular 4k iptv subs.

Legality, Safety, and Risks Associated with IPTV

The legality of 4k iptv subs is a complex topic. There are legitimate IPTV providers that license their content and operate within copyright laws. However, a significant portion of the IPTV market consists of services that illegally re-stream copyrighted content without proper licenses. Subscribing to these unauthorized services carries legal risks, as intellectual property rights holders actively pursue such operations.

When considering 4k iptv subs, it’s essential to research the provider thoroughly. Look for transparent information about their content licensing and business practices. Using a Virtual Private Network (VPN) is highly recommended, especially if you are unsure about the legality of your chosen service. A VPN encrypts your internet traffic and masks your IP address, enhancing your online privacy and security.

Beyond legal concerns, there are also security risks. Shady providers might distribute malware through their apps or websites. Always download apps from official app stores or trusted sources. Be cautious about providing personal and payment information to unknown entities. Stick to well-reviewed providers to minimize exposure to these risks.
